Comparative Analysis of User Interface and Accessibility in Leading Video Editing Apps
When examining the user interface (UI) of the leading video editing apps, a clear distinction emerges between platforms prioritizing simplicity and those designed for expansive functionality. Apps like InShot and CapCut offer streamlined interfaces with minimalistic iconography and gesture-based controls, which significantly reduce the learning curve for newcomers. Conversely, professional-grade tools such as Adobe Premiere Rush incorporate multi-layer timelines and customizable panels, affording users advanced control but demanding greater familiarity with video editing concepts. The balance between intuitiveness and depth can be crucial depending on whether the user is a casual creator or a seasoned professional.
Accessibility remains a pivotal factor in enhancing user experience across diverse audiences. Key features such as voice commands, screen reader compatibility, and adjustable text sizes are increasingly integrated into these platforms. Below is a comparative overview emphasizing accessibility features that can make a dramatic difference in usability:
| App | Voice Commands | Screen Reader | Text Size Adjustment | Color Contrast Options |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| InShot | Limited | Basic Support | Yes | No |
| CapCut | Yes | Enhanced Support | Yes | Yes |
| Adobe Premiere Rush | Advanced | Full Support | Yes | Yes |
| FilmoraGo | No | Basic Support | No | No |
Ultimately, the optimal choice depends on user priorities: those emphasizing speed and ease of use may gravitate toward apps with simplified UI and essential accessibility, while creators demanding comprehensive customization will prefer tools equipped with advanced accessibility frameworks ensuring seamless workflow across all user capabilities.

Strategic Recommendations for Selecting Video Editing Apps Based on Content Goals and Audience Engagement
When choosing a video editing app for social media, it is essential to align the app’s features with your specific content goals. For instance, creators focusing on dynamic storytelling should prioritize apps with advanced trimming tools, multi-layer editing, and seamless audio integration. Conversely, developers aiming for rapid content output might benefit from apps offering intuitive templates and one-tap filters that speed up the editing process without compromising quality. Additionally, consider whether your content requires high-resolution exports, adjustable frame rates, or customizable text animations to enhance visual appeal.
Audience engagement metrics also play a crucial role in app selection. Apps that enable direct integration with major social platforms, facilitate interactive features like polls or clickable links, and offer analytics support help creators refine their strategy in real time. Below is a summarized guideline to match app capabilities with strategic content outcomes:
| Content Goal | Recommended App Features | Audience Engagement Benefits |
|---|---|---|
| Storytelling & Branding | Multi-layer editing, Color grading, Custom fonts | Enhanced emotional appeal, consistent brand identity |
| Fast Turnaround | Templates, Auto-enhance, One-click export | More frequent posts, higher volume engagement |
| Interactive Content | Social media integrations, Interactive overlays | Increased user participation, real-time feedback |
| Quality & Detail | High-resolution output, Precise editing tools | Greater viewer retention, professional aesthetics |
Cultivating a strategic approach that marries both technical features and audience behavior insights ultimately empowers content creators to maximize the impact of their social media videos, driving sustained engagement and growth.
